New Child Abuse Prevention Policies Proposed for California: New legislation introduced Tuesday in the California State Assembly will create new mandates for youth organizations to prevent child abuse. Submitted by Assemblywoman Lorena Gonzalez (D-San Diego), non-profits would need to devise abuse prevention strategies to secure insurance and volunteers who commit a certain number of hours monthly or annually to serve as reporters. How can Consumers Pursue a Products Liability Claim?: Consumers want to believe that the products they buy are safe for both themselves and their family to use. Unfortunately, that is not always the case. The statistics are startling; product defects result in nearly three million injuries and 22,000 fatalities every year in the United States, according to the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C).
